Job Summary:
To perform tasks necessary for maintaining continuous materials supply at each machine to enable efficient operations without disruption due to lack of materials.
Job Duties:
• Maintains a clean and orderly work area/warehouse
• Maintains a safe working environment by following all company safety policies and procedures and reports unsafe conditions and incidents, while maintaining quality standards
• Maintains company’s quality standards and follows computer procedures to handle damaged material and quarantine material
• Reads work order or follows verbal instructions to ascertain materials or containers to be moved
• Opens containers to prepare to be moved
• Loads and unloads materials onto or from pallets, trays, racks, and shelves by hand
• Conveys materials from storage or work sites to designated area
• Attaches identifying tags or labels to materials or marks information on cases, bales, or other containers
• Loads truck
• Lifts heavy objects by hand or with power hoist, and cleans work area, machines, and equipment to assist machine operators
• Operates industrial truck or electric hoist to assist in loading or moving materials and products
• Brings and takes away all Gaylord boxes for recycling to machines
• Brings and takes away skids for machine operators jobs
• Bands and stores all endplates, skids, and recyclable material
• Empties all trash throughout shop
Job Qualifications:
• High school diploma or General Education Diploma (GED) required
• Must have tow motor experience and be able to successfully complete tow motor certification training
• Ability to multi task and read production tickets
• Ability to perform math calculations including fractions
• Must be able to read tape measure, including micrometer
• Must be computer literate
• Ability to maintain production standards
• Must be dedicated to continuous improvement
• Must be able to lift 50 pounds, bend, stretch, or stand for extended periods of time
